Starterkit STKa8Xx

Product Heading

The Embedded Starterkit STKa8Xx is tailored for embedded computing engineers and is based on the TQMa8Xx platform, leveraging the power of the Arm Cortex-A35 processor from NXP's i.MX8X series. This kit excels in graphics performance, offering 4K support, making it a great fit for applications with high display requirements. It's also equipped with a DSP for audio processing, providing advanced sound capabilities. Furthermore, the kit incorporates essential security functions and an integrated Cortex-M4 CPU, ensuring real-time and security applications run smoothly. Despite its powerful features, it maintains low power consumption, typically around 4 watts.

Specifications

Specifications

 

CPU
  • Cortex®-A35 Technology
  • i.MX8X Dual Plus
  • i.MX8X Quad Plus
Memory
  • DDR3L-SDRAM: Up to 2 GB with ECC protection
  • Quad SPI NOR: Up to 256 MB
  • Up to 64 GB eMMC Flash
  • EEPROM: 0/64-kbit
Graphics
  • Dual LVDS Interface / 2xMIPI DSI
  • 1x MIPI CSI
Communications Interfaces
  • Up to 2x Ethernet 10/100/1000 Mbit
  • Up to 1x USB 3.0 OTG interface
  • Up to 2x USB 2.0 OTG interface
  • Up to 4x UART
  • Up to 3x CAN FD
Other Interfaces
  • 1x SDIO/MMC
  • 1x PCIe
  • Up to 8x I²C
  • Up to 4x SPI
  • Up to 2 Q-SPI
  • Up to 2x SPDIF
  • Up to 4x ESAI
  • Up to 32 GPIO
General
  • Power supply 3.3 V
  • Ambient conditions
    • Standard temperature range: -25°C…+85°C
    • Extended temperature range: -40°C…+85°C
    • Dimensions 55 mm x 44 mm
  • Plug-in system Board-to-board plug-in system 280 pins
OS
  • Linux
  • PikeOS
  • QNX on request
  • Android on request

Starterkit STK8Xx set
  • The core of the STKa8Xx set is the TQMa8Xx module with a i.MX8X Cortex®-A35 CPU. The components contained in the starter kit constitute a modular system enabling you to develop your own product ideas. Development of graphic interfaces can be started immediately using a TQ display kit which is adjusted for a starter kit. To develop your own hardware you can use the certified and qualified circuit components of the starter kit in your own designs.
